Declaration by the Committee of Ministers on the Protection of Freedom of Expression and Information and Freedom of Assembly and Association with Regard to Internet Domain Mames and Name Strings

Resolutions and Declarations

The declaration declares its support for the recognition by member states of the need to apply fundamental rights safeguards to the management of domain names. In this context, it alerts to the risk which over-regulation of the domain name space and name strings entails for the exercise of freedom of expression and the right to receive and impart information and of freedom of assembly and association. The declaration therefore calls on the competent Council of Europe bodies to work with relevant corporations, agencies and other entities that manage or contribute to the management of the domain name space in order for decisions to take full account of international law, including international human rights law.
